Output e99018fcbf440eef7e3ba2d78710a02df6108f102c01e46429912700a0c43bf6:6

value
3750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b0e2b24a79ba8a3cb1ee5daf8a341e7e742d1f1 OP_EQUAL
address
3Jk5Frz99tW7bEBLJQ3Q4MJq5LzBEwxEem
transaction
e99018fcbf440eef7e3ba2d78710a02df6108f102c01e46429912700a0c43bf6
spent
true